空间数据矢量模型之DIME模型与PLOYVRT模型
网络拓扑模型:
① DIME模型(Dual Independent Map Model 双重独立地图编码模型):DIME文件是最早的矢量模型中含有多边形间邻接关系的模型;是由美国人口统计局为存储城市统计区的线状面块而设计出来的,它能够根据街道的地理位置将街道匹配到城市统计区中,从而方便统计局进行人口普查。
DIME文件的基本单元是DIME段,一个DIME段即是一部分街道,行政区界,水涯线或铁路线等的直线段。对于每个段,两个端点ID分别有方向性的“起始”和“终止”。基于这个方向,多边形ID相应地记录为左或右多边形(针对该DIEM段)
优点:DIME数据结构相对于路径拓扑模型(将二维要素的边界作为独立的一维要素来单独处理,而不考虑要素之间的关系,典型的路径拓扑模型有面条模型,多边形模型,点位字典模型)来说具有一定的优点,其多边形之间的邻接性可以很容易访问,通过双向关系“起始”和“终止”以及左右多边形使得编辑,检索DIME基础文件变得容易。
缺点:在DIME中,由于线状地理要素的路径拓扑没有显式定义,因此,获取多边形轮廓线是相当复杂的。
② PLOYVRT模型(POLYgon convertor 多边形转换器):polyvrt系统,美国计算机图形与空间分析实验室基于弧段结构构造;将弧段的关系按DIME给出,弧段的端点被称为结点而不是点,结点与点严格区分;(POLYVRT模型综合了弧段/点位字典模型和DIME模型,但它的点位字典划分为独立的点和结点。因此POLYVRT模型与DIME模型的区别在于边的不同选择,而边是用来描述多边形之间关系并作为关系文件记录的基本单元)